Celebrate the Winter Olympics with this special Commemorative Coin! The Vancouver 2010 Olympic Winter Games Silver Maple Leaf coin is made by The Royal Canadian Mint and bears a $5 face value. The reverse of the coin features an ice hockey player in full stride, flanked by two maple leaves. The design is the product of collaboration between the Mints Bullion and Refinery and Engraving teams. These handsome commemorative collectible coins have a weight of one troy ounce and are certified 99.99% pure silver, making them the highest purity silver coins struck by a government mint.
